Scientific Publications

Some recent journal and conference publications from the ASN team:

  • Ernst, Krishnamoorthy, Sier and Marquez, Solving regional infrastructure bottlenecks: rail allocation policies for a coal terminal, Australasian J Regional Studies, 14(2), 2008.
  • Ernst, Horn, Krishnamoorthy, Static and Dynamic Order Scheduling for Recreational Rental Vehicles at Tourism Holdings Limited, Interfaces 37(4), July-August 2007.
  • Mak and Ernst (2007) New cutting-planes for the time- and/or precedence-constrained ATSP and directed VRP, Mathematical Methods of Operations Research, 66, pp. 69--98.
  • Horn, Jiang and Kilby, Scheduling patrol boats and crews for the Royal Australian Navy, J. OR Society 58(10), 2007.
  • Robinson, Simple procedures for data analysis based on continuous-time Brownian motion, JRSSC 2008.
  • Singh, Performance of critical path type algorithms with communication delays, International Journal of Operations research 4(2), pp 90-97, 2007.
  • Weiskircher et al, A branch-and-cut approach to the crossing number problem, Discrete Optimization.
  • A. Ernst, G. Singh, Taming Wind Energy with Battery Storage, The International Conference Operations Research 2007, September 5-7, 2007, Saarbrücken, Germany, pp. 199-204.
  • Cleary, Robinson, Owen, Golding, A study of falling-stream cutters using discrete element modelling with non-spherical particles, WCSB3 2007.
  • Robinson, Ernst and Sier, Grade Control Decisions That Take Amounts Of Uncertainty Into Account, WCSB3 2007, pp. 269-280.
  • Robinson, Sinnott, Cleary, Do Cross-Belt Sample Cutters Really Need To Travel At 1.5 Times Belt Speed?, WCSB3 2007.
  • D.R. Thiruvady, B. Meyer and A.T. Ernst, Strip Packing with Hybrid ACO: Placement Order is Learnable, IEEE Congress on Evolutionary Computation (Hong Kong), pp. 1207-1213
  • A. Ernst, G. Singh, R.Weiskircher, Scheduling Meetings at Trade Events with Complex Preferences, The Eighteenth International Conference on Automated Planning and Scheduling (ICAPS08), September 14-18 2008, Sydney, Australia.
  • G. Singh, R. Weiskircher, Collaborative Resource Constraint Scheduling with a Fractional Shared Resource, 2008 IEEE/WIC/ACM International Conference on Intelligent Agent Technology (IAT-08), December 9-12 2008, Sydney, Australia.
  • Weiskircher, Dunstall and Kontoleon, Controlling CHP micro-turbines as a virtual power plant, Sustainable Buildings 2008, Melbourne, September 21-25, 2008.
